A chemical equation shows the starting compound(s)—the reactants—on the left and the final compound(s)—the products—on the right, separated by an arrow. Reagents and conditions are drawn above. The type of reaction arrow describes the direction in which the chemical reaction proceeds: This is a reaction arrow depicting conversion of one molecule to another: The symbol → means the. An energy requirement for a reaction is typically displayed above the arrow. The most common reaction arrow points from left to right.
